When considering HVAC system installation, understanding the essential components is crucial. Most systems encompass a furnace, air conditioning unit, ductwork, and a thermostat. Each component plays an important role in regulating temperature and maintaining indoor air quality.


Selecting the proper HVAC system requires evaluating the size of your house. An oversized system can cycle on and off incessantly, resulting in inefficiency and higher utility payments. Conversely, an undersized unit might battle to take care of comfy temperatures, causing discomfort throughout extreme weather.

Before installation, assessing the present infrastructure is important. This includes analyzing ductwork and existing items to discover out if modifications or upgrades are wanted. Older ductwork may be much less environment friendly, resulting in air leaks and decreased system performance. Upgrading could involve sealing ducts or putting in new ones if required.

Choosing the proper sort of HVAC system can considerably influence consolation and vitality efficiency. Common choices include split methods, central air items, and heat pumps. Each sort has its advantages and downsides, making it important to think about your particular wants and native climate conditions when making a choice.


The installation process typically begins with removing the old system, which could be cumbersome. Proper safety protocols should be adopted to make sure each the installer and home-owner stay secure. Disconnecting energy and addressing refrigerant safely can stop potential hazards during this phase.


Once the old unit is out, the new system usually follows a structured installation plan. For central air conditioning, this step usually involves placing the out of doors condenser unit in a spot that allows for optimal airflow. Consideration of native codes and regulations is also required to make sure compliance.


Ductwork installation or modification is crucial for a model new HVAC system. Ensuring that ducts are correctly sealed and insulated will assist environment friendly airflow. Poorly installed ducts can lead to vital energy loss and discomfort, highlighting the need for precision in ductwork dealing with.

Thermostat installation performs a significant position in managing climate control features. Programmable thermostats permit homeowners to set specific temperatures at numerous times, optimizing vitality use. This feature can translate into substantial cost financial savings over time while maintaining convenience.


Testing the system after installation is important to ensure every thing operates as anticipated. Checking airflow, refrigerant ranges, and electrical components addresses potential issues before they escalate. A comprehensive inspection ensures that the system is not only useful but additionally efficient.


Ongoing maintenance post-installation is essential for long-term performance. Regularly altering air filters and scheduling skilled inspections will prolong the lifespan of your HVAC system. Preventive maintenance can avert expensive repairs and keep your system working effectively, sustaining comfy indoor temperatures.

Homeowners ought to contemplate potential energy efficiency ratings when selecting their HVAC system. Systems with greater Seasonal Energy Efficiency Ratios (SEER) typically consume much less energy, which translates to lower utility bills. The funding in a high-efficiency system usually pays off over time with cost savings.


Considering the installation location is vital to overall efficiency. Keeping the out of doors unit shaded can improve efficiency in the course of the hotter months. Proper placement also ensures the system operates quietly, minimizing disturbance to the family.


Focusing on indoor air quality during installation can improve the dwelling surroundings. Air purifiers and dehumidifiers can be integrated into the system to enhance overall air situations - Emergency HVAC Services Canoga Park. This consideration benefits homeowners seeking to cut back allergens and different airborne pollutants.

Regular maintenance is key to ensuring your HVAC system runs effectively. Schedule annual inspections, exchange air filters month-to-month, clean the out of doors unit, and examine for any leaks or unusual noises. Keeping up with maintenance can lengthen the life of your system.

Look for the Seasonal Energy Efficiency Ratio (SEER) for cooling systems and the Annual Fuel Utilization Efficiency (AFUE) rating for heating systems. Higher ratings point out higher vitality efficiency, which can lead to decrease utility payments and a lowered environmental influence.
